Subject: Pilot Churn — Where We Stand

Welcome aboard. Quick snapshot before your first exec session: the Fernley pilot lost four of twenty customers last month, mostly citing onboarding friction rather than price. Dalia's team is reworking the setup flow now. Worth digging into before you meet the group. One thing you should know going in.

internal memo for kahop-yajof: The steering committee signed off on a budget of $12.6 million for Project Jorwyn. The renewal with Quenoxox Logistics closes at $16.8 million a year, 48 percent above the last contract.

# Approvals: Database Connection Pooling

This page covers approval requirements for changes to the shared connection pooler (Pondkeeper) used by the Ledgerline services. Pool size, timeout, and eviction settings are production-sensitive; a misconfigured pool has previously caused cascading connection exhaustion. Any change to pooler config requires a staging soak of 24 hours and a written approval recorded on this page. Config changes without approval will be reverted. The current approver of record is listed below.

approver of yajef-fajef = Oliwyn Silion Kasok Kasox

## Deployment: Upstream Circuit Breaker

The Quillgate service calls the Fernwhistle pricing API, which flakes under load. We wrap every call in a circuit breaker: five consecutive failures trip it, then a 30-second cooldown before half-open probes. Do not disable it in staging; that's how the last outage happened. Tune thresholds only with sign-off from the platform lead. The breaker reads the following configuration values at startup.

config for bagep-kageg:
ULADOR_LOG_LEVEL=warn
ULADOR_METRICS_HOST=metrics.ulador.tolvaqcorp.corp
ULADOR_POOL_SIZE=32